Output de4dec7115afaa4ed8d2b1c819020bb3b02bac4fbc690aaa62e89fc637bf8024:1

value
542001334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ca6920981cc7291d0a412fe44c707a970b7c573 OP_EQUAL
address
34JWPS5re2p1hc5cqJDxkPA2Azm8bCGi3h
transaction
de4dec7115afaa4ed8d2b1c819020bb3b02bac4fbc690aaa62e89fc637bf8024
confirmations
463714
spent
true